Action Steps
  1. Assess environmental factors affecting edge computing and IIoT deployments
  2. Evaluate ruggedized hardware options for edge devices
  3. Implement edge computing solutions with built-in redundancy and failover capabilities
  4. Configure edge devices for remote monitoring and management
  5. Test and validate ruggedized solutions in simulated harsh environments
